Back to Blog

Chinese-Made NI Alternative: Artix-7 FPGA+AI Based 16-Channel, 16-bit Vibration PCIe Data Acquisition Card

#FPGADev#AI

Overview of the 16-Channel Vibration PCIe Acquisition Card

In this article, we will explore the features and capabilities of a 16-channel, 16-bit vibration PCIe acquisition card that utilizes the XC7A100T-2FGG484I FPGA. This card is specifically designed for industrial applications, providing a cost-effective solution for data acquisition in environments where high sampling resolution is not a primary concern.

Key Features

FPGA Integration

The heart of this acquisition card is the XC7A100T-2FGG484I FPGA from Xilinx's Artix-7 series. This FPGA is known for its balance of performance and power efficiency, making it suitable for industrial applications. The card leverages the FPGA's capabilities to handle multiple data channels simultaneously, ensuring efficient data processing and transfer.

PCIe Interface

The card is designed as an auxiliary component that can be easily inserted into the PCIe slots of an industrial or desktop PC. This design allows for straightforward integration into existing systems, enabling users to enhance their data acquisition capabilities without the need for extensive modifications to their hardware setup. The PCIe interface facilitates high-speed data transfer between the acquisition card and the CPU, ensuring that the data collected is readily available for processing.

Channel Configuration

This acquisition card supports 16 channels for data collection. Each channel can capture 16-bit data, making it suitable for a variety of vibration measurement applications. The ability to expand the number of channels is contingent upon the number of available PCIe slots in the host PC. Therefore, users can scale their data acquisition system by adding more cards, with the total number of channels calculated as follows:

Total Channels = Number of PCIe Slots * 16

This flexibility allows users to tailor their data acquisition setup to meet specific requirements, whether they are monitoring a single machine or an entire production line.

Applications

The 16-channel vibration PCIe acquisition card is ideal for applications where cost is a critical factor, and high sampling rates are not necessary. Common use cases include:

  • Industrial Machinery Monitoring: The card can be used to monitor vibrations in various industrial machines, helping to identify potential issues before they lead to equipment failure.
  • Structural Health Monitoring: It can be employed in the monitoring of buildings and bridges, providing valuable data that can be used to assess structural integrity.
  • Research and Development: Engineers and researchers can utilize this card in experimental setups where vibration data collection is required.

Conclusion

The 16-channel, 16-bit vibration PCIe acquisition card utilizing the XC7A100T-2FGG484I FPGA represents a robust solution for industrial data acquisition needs. Its integration into existing systems via the PCIe interface, combined with the flexibility of channel expansion, makes it an attractive option for various applications. Whether you are looking to enhance your industrial monitoring capabilities or conduct research, this card provides a cost-effective and efficient means of collecting and processing vibration data.